How to Transfer Account to a New Owner
Transfer your Local Business Pro account when changing owners. Update name, email, and password for the new user.
Quick Answer: Update the name, change the email to the new owner's address (they verify it), then have them change the password. The account transfers without losing data.
Step-by-Step Transfer
- Log in as the current owner
- Navigate to Account > Account Info
- Update the First Name and Last Name
- Click Change Email and enter the new owner's email
- Have the new owner verify their email
- New owner logs in and changes the password
- Update payment information in Billing if needed
Important Considerations
- All data transfers - Contacts, jobs, history remain
- Update payment - New owner should add their own card
- Remove old cards - Previous owner's payment info should be deleted
- Team members - Review team access after transfer
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Do I lose any data when transferring?
A: No, all business data, contacts, and history remain intact.
Q: Can the previous owner still access the account?
A: Not after the email and password are changed.
